About this episode
David Gan discusses his journey from investment banking to founding Inception Capital and the evolving landscape of crypto in Asia.
In this episode of Inside the Hutt, Brooke Pollack interviews David Gan, founder of Inception Capital. David discusses his journey from investment banking to crypto, including his time at Huobi and the launch of Inception Capital. He breaks down Inception’s two-pronged model—a venture fund and a fund of funds—highlighting their early-stage strategy, cross-border support, and commitment to backing emerging managers. The conversation also explores tokenization, Asia's evolving crypto landscape, exchange listings, and how David's experience and global network help founders scale across markets. Key Points From This Episode: David Gan’s professional background and time at Huobi. Founding Inception Capital and its evolution from Huobi Capital. Structure of Inception’s two funds: early-stage venture and fund of funds. Strategy behind taking GP stakes in emerging managers and scaling them. David’s investment focus on infrastructure, financial services, and tokenization. Insights on helping U.S. startups expand into Asia and vice versa.
